Use the extension Copy Url+ of Firefox to write those elctronic references of APA Style.

After the extension installed, you need to add a file named user.js placed at user's directory to customed the APA Style.[1]

user_pref('copyurlplus.menus.1.label', 'Copy URL (APA Style)');

user_pref('copyurlplus.menus.1.copy', 'Author (date) %TITLE%. Retrieved %LOCAL_TIME%, from %URL%');

For example, the Copy URL+ result of this webpage titled Firefox Help: Keyboard Shortcuts will be
Author (date) Firefox Help: Keyboard Shortcuts. Retrieved Thursday, December 09, 2004 23:25:12, from

The flaw is could not to custom the detail of time stamp more flexibly.
[1] Due to the locatin of user's directory depend on your OS, please read copyurlplus: customize
[2] Jedi: 我在用的 Firefox 1.0 PR 延伸套件 2004-10-81 (written in chinese)